Britain and the European Union should resolve trade and other issues related to Britain`s exit from the bloc separately from discussions about a security pact with the UK, European Commission chief Jean-Claude Juncker said on Saturday.
"We need a security alliance between the UK and the EU, but we can`t mix that question up with other questions relating to Brexit," Juncker told the annual Munich Security Conference.
"I wouldn`t like to put security policy considerations with trade policy considerations in one hat. I understand why some would like to do that, but we don`t want to," he said.
